From 13a58c9f8be234576c94221c2feab3aa4f6b9562 Mon Sep 17 00:00:00 2001 From: Diego Marquez Date: Fri, 21 Nov 2025 22:48:37 -0500 Subject: [PATCH 1/3] test: set up test releaase candidate branches This repo has a small blast radius for release testing. We aim to test the rc`n` versioning schema soon to be provided by https://github.com/googleapis/release-please/pull/2622. Additionally, we test with `prerelease` to understand its behavior. --- .github/release-please.yml | 11 +++++++++++ 1 file changed, 11 insertions(+) diff --git a/.github/release-please.yml b/.github/release-please.yml index 63c776ff..bcf6f009 100644 --- a/.github/release-please.yml +++ b/.github/release-please.yml @@ -6,3 +6,14 @@ branches: handleGHRelease: true releaseType: java-yoshi branch: java7 +- bumpMinorPreMajor: true + handleGHRelease: true + releaseType: java-yoshi + prereleaseType: rc + prerelease: true + branch: test-protobuf-4.x-prerelease +- bumpMinorPreMajor: true + handleGHRelease: true + releaseType: java-yoshi + releaseAs: 2.0.0-rc1 + branch: test-protobuf-4.x-rc From b8e724b65a5c8b0067927be4b6865c21db3d39d2 Mon Sep 17 00:00:00 2001 From: Diego Marquez Date: Tue, 25 Nov 2025 12:14:31 -0500 Subject: [PATCH 2/3] chore: use prerelease mode only Removed prerelease settings and adjusted branch for release. --- .github/release-please.yml | 6 ------ 1 file changed, 6 deletions(-) diff --git a/.github/release-please.yml b/.github/release-please.yml index bcf6f009..d32329b2 100644 --- a/.github/release-please.yml +++ b/.github/release-please.yml @@ -9,11 +9,5 @@ branches: - bumpMinorPreMajor: true handleGHRelease: true releaseType: java-yoshi - prereleaseType: rc prerelease: true - branch: test-protobuf-4.x-prerelease -- bumpMinorPreMajor: true - handleGHRelease: true - releaseType: java-yoshi - releaseAs: 2.0.0-rc1 branch: test-protobuf-4.x-rc From ff4879d0c76af3d18153232836bc6b6054bcebb5 Mon Sep 17 00:00:00 2001 From: Diego Marquez Date: Tue, 25 Nov 2025 12:15:16 -0500 Subject: [PATCH 3/3] chore: use base flags --- .github/release-please.yml | 1 - 1 file changed, 1 deletion(-) diff --git a/.github/release-please.yml b/.github/release-please.yml index d32329b2..470ae2f1 100644 --- a/.github/release-please.yml +++ b/.github/release-please.yml @@ -9,5 +9,4 @@ branches: - bumpMinorPreMajor: true handleGHRelease: true releaseType: java-yoshi - prerelease: true branch: test-protobuf-4.x-rc